在数字化时代,数据库管理系统的选择直接影响着数据处理的效率与安全性。作为全球最受欢迎的开源关系型数据库之一,MySQL凭借其稳定性、高性能和灵活性,成为开发者、企业乃至个人用户的首选。本文将为您详细解析MySQL的下载流程、安装步骤及核心功能,助您快速掌握这一工具的精髓。
一、MySQL的核心特点与适用场景
MySQL 8.0及以上版本(截至2025年4月,最新版本为9.2.0)在功能上持续优化,主要体现在以下几个方面:
1. 高性能与扩展性
2. 开源性与企业级支持
3. 跨平台兼容性
4. 安全性强化
适用人群:普通用户(如学生、个人开发者)可快速搭建本地数据库;企业用户可通过集群版构建高可用架构;开发者可利用存储过程、触发器实现复杂业务逻辑。
二、MySQL下载流程详解
1. 官网访问与版本选择
进入MySQL官方网站(),选择对应操作系统的安装包:
注意:官网提供在线安装(约2.4MB)和离线安装(约437MB)两种方式。离线包更适合网络不稳定环境。
2. 绕过账号注册
点击下载页面底部的“No thanks, just start my download”即可跳过登录步骤直接获取安装包。
三、Windows系统安装教程(以MySQL 8.0为例)
步骤1:卸载旧版本(关键!)
80%的安装失败源于旧版本残留。需依次执行:
1. 停止MySQL服务(命令:`net stop MySQL80`)。
2. 删除安装目录(默认路径:`C:Program FilesMySQL`)及数据目录(`C:ProgramDataMySQL`)。
3. 清理注册表(使用`regedit`搜索并删除MySQL相关项)。
步骤2:运行安装程序
1. 双击MSI文件,选择Custom(自定义安装)以控制组件和路径。
2. 修改安装路径:建议将默认的`C:`改为`D:`以节省系统盘空间。
3. 安装依赖库:若提示缺少C++组件,按向导自动安装即可。
步骤3:配置服务器
1. 认证方式选择:
2. 设置root密码:建议使用“字母+数字+符号”组合,避免简单密码。
3. 服务名称与端口:默认`MySQL80`和`3306`,可自定义以避免冲突。
步骤4:环境变量配置
1. 进入“系统属性→环境变量→Path”,添加MySQL的`bin`目录路径(如`D:MySQLbin`)。
2. 验证:在命令行输入`mysql -V`,显示版本号即表示成功。
四、Linux系统快速安装指南
Ubuntu/Debian示例:
bash
sudo apt update
sudo apt install mysql-server
sudo systemctl start mysql
sudo mysql_secure_installation 安全配置向导
注意:默认启用`auth_socket`插件,需通过`ALTER USER`命令切换为密码登录。
五、安全性最佳实践
1. 权限管理:
2. 数据加密:
3. 备份与监控:
六、用户评价与未来展望
用户反馈:
未来趋势:
MySQL作为历经30年迭代的数据库标杆,始终在性能与易用性之间寻求平衡。无论是个人开发者还是企业团队,通过本文的指南均可快速搭建安全高效的数据库环境。随着云计算和AI技术的融合,MySQL将继续引领数据管理的创新浪潮。
关键词:MySQL下载、安装教程、安全性配置、云数据库、新特性解析
相关链接:[MySQL官网] | [腾讯云MySQL文档] | [阿里云参数配置]
通过结构化步骤、安全建议与未来趋势分析,本文旨在为不同层次的读者提供实用价值,同时兼顾搜索引擎优化,助力用户高效获取所需信息。